Cristiano Mangovo

BIOGRAPHY

Cristiano Mangovo is an Angolan contemporary artist (born in Cabinda in 1982) who lives and works between Lisbon and Luanda. With training in painting at the Academy of Fine Arts in Kinshasa and experience in scenography and performance, his work combines expressionism and surrealism with powerful social commentary. His canvases and installations often depict distorted human and animal forms, vibrant colors, and recurring two-mouthed faces—symbols of power, inequality, and environmental conflict. Through his art, Mangovo critiques systems of domination and advocates for ecological balance, cultural memory, and social justice
